Job Summary:
Cardiac Catheterization Laboratory (CCL) Technologist and Registered Nurse positions are available in Nashville, Tennessee. These roles involve supporting a comprehensive cardiac program known for advanced procedures such as diagnostic studies, PCI, TAVR, and electrophysiology services. Candidates will join a dedicated team utilizing state-of-the-art equipment in a fast-paced, high-quality environment.
Job Details:
- Schedule: 4 x 10-hour shifts, beginning at 6:30 a.m., with a minimum of 40 hours per week
- Required Qualifications: Valid RN license or appropriate technologist certification (RCIS, RCES, or RT(R)), BLS, ACLS, at least 2 years of experience in cath lab or electrophysiology procedures, and ability to perform diagnostic and interventional cardiac procedures.
- Preferred Qualifications: Experience with advanced cardiac procedures, familiarity with GE and Philips x-ray systems, Volcano IVUS/FFR equipment, and procedures such as laser atherectomies, ECMO, TAVR, and complex PCI.
- Additional Information: The role involves working with highly specialized equipment including Merge Hemo and Meditech documentation systems. Candidates should demonstrate strong clinical skills and the ability to adapt to new technologies. The unit maintains high standards, with a focus on patient safety and team collaboration.

About
Nashville is Tennessee's capital city and lies along the Cumberland River. With its mild climate, it’s enjoyable to live, work and play in this musical city year-round. Nashville’s music scene has many draws, with attractions like the Grand Ole Opry, the Musicians Hall of Fame & Museum, the Country Music Hall of Fame & Museum and countless honky-tonk bars. Even if you aren't into music, other attractions appeal to a wide array of tastes, including historical landmarks like Andrew Jackson's Hermitage, where visitors can get an up-close look at the seventh president's home life on a guided tour. The Adventure Science Center, the Frist Art Museum and the Tennessee State Museum are just a few other popular institutions. Shopping enthusiasts won't want to miss Marathon Village, a former automobile plant, now serving as a contemporary space for art galleries, studios and flagship stores like Jack Daniel's General Store.
